What is a Google Penalty Removal?
The inner workings of Google’s algorithm can be complicated and confusing.
Sometimes your website will be issued a penalty from Google – or worse – it’ll be blacklisted. This can have a devastating effect on a business that relies on its website to generate and convert leads.
There are several reasons why you may be issued with a penalty: if your website uses too many keywords (Google will consider this as spam), content that goes against Google’s guidelines, or outdated SEO strategies being used.

How we will help
Our in-house team will help you out of any penalty jam. Here’s how:
- We will perform an in-depth forensic link audit of your website’s links, which are often the reason why your site has received a penalty. This audit will provide the knowledge we need to construct an effective recovery strategy.
- If third-party links are the issue (or if we believe they are negatively impacting your SEO strategy in any way), we will remove them from the third-party companies.
- Our strategy will implement Google’s disavow file to demonstrate to the search engine that the penalty culprits have been identified and removed, therefore allowing Google to feel confident that your website is playing by the rules.
- Once the above steps have been completed, we will then work with you to create a reconsideration request to hopefully eliminate any further delays.
